Transaction 63075cf754e909b2b0b022060d2521680f34ecb51c2784bc147438bb6bb59e58
1 Input
2 Outputs
- 63075cf754e909b2b0b022060d2521680f34ecb51c2784bc147438bb6bb59e58:0
- 63075cf754e909b2b0b022060d2521680f34ecb51c2784bc147438bb6bb59e58:1
value 1000073
address 3EEwPZZ6pYRJSotCz9RBoVYPRnoWyGWEka
value 4618000
address 3PAS5aS36rvwwzFExSGCbGFaHho36Rvreb